Owner shall indemnify <br />and hold harmless City (and any governmental body or utility authority properly using the Dedicated <br />Areas) from and against all expenses, costs, or claims for any damages to the Improvement(s) which <br />may result from the use of the right-of-way by City or other governmental body or authority due to <br />maintenance, construction,, installation, or other proper use within the Dedicated Areas. <br />7. INSURANCE. Throughout the duration of this Agreement, including the initial <br />period and any extensions thereto, Owner shall obtain and possess: <br />a) Commercial General Liability coverage, issued on the most recent version of the ISO form as filed <br />for use in Florida or its equivalent, for all operations under this Agreement, including but not limited <br />to Contractual, Products and Completed Operations, and Personal Injury. CGL limits may, from <br />time to time, be adjusted at the discretion of the City to reflect the then current general acceptable <br />policy limits. The limits shall be not less than $1,000,000 Combined Single Limits (CSL) or its <br />equivalent per occurrence. Such coverage shall not contain any endorsement(s) excluding or <br />limiting Product/Completed Operations, Contractual Liability, or Severability of Interests, and must <br />include a duty to defend.
